The highlights of mineral exploration during the Independence period include the discovery of new coalfields in the Bankura , Karanpura and Singrauli areas . The 132 - metre thick Jhingurda seam in Singrauli is perhaps the second ...

The basic tool for exploration is sound geological reasoning . Search for a matching geological set - up as a first step has yielded very fruitful results . Recent success in locating the phosphorite deposits in Udaipur ( Muktinath ...
